It is portion of a rising pattern of Y2K trend and what has been known as “nowstalgia” among Gen Z, who are reliving early 2000s trend tendencies they were being much too younger to knowledge or remember the to start with time close to.

“I consider there’s like this resurgence of what was so amazing in the 2000s … now that it is coming back, it is like you want to infuse it with today’s pop lifestyle,” said Lisa Sahakian, CEO and founder of Ian Charms.

It’s not just beaded necklaces coming again into model. Legendary manner trends of the early 2000s like bucket hats, small-rise denims, and babydoll T-shirts are all possessing a resurgence among younger people. This classic renaissance has also led to an explosion in thrifting among the Gen Z, and a increase in websites that provide thrifted garments like Depop and Poshmark.

The frenzy more than thrifted apparel is starting up to manifest in brick-and mortar retailers, and in Manhattan’s Reduced East Aspect two classic thrift shops, Bowery Showroom and Rogue, have led a corner of Stanton Street to be dubbed the “TikTok Block” simply because of the app’s part in the increase of these Gen Z tendencies.

“Back in 2018, I made the decision on a whim to start posting on Depop. I found these classic Skechers … I realized a person would appreciate them. And within an hour of me submitting them, I experienced individuals fighting around them. So variety of like a change went off at that instant, I was like, ‘OK, I have some thing listed here,’” reported Emma Rogue, 25, who owns Rogue.

Depop, wherever Rogue suggests her journey to starting to be a vintage seller commenced, has been a bastion of thrifting amongst Gen Z. The site has much more than 30 million users, 90 p.c of whom are underneath the age of 26, in accordance to the platform. To day, Depop sellers have offered much more than a billion pounds really worth of classic products.

Rogue became a feeling on TikTok, demonstrating off thrifted Y2K things on the app that she was advertising on her Depop. Past 12 months, she explained a video clip of her packing an buy on Depop went viral overnight with extra than a million views on that put up. Her subsequent on the system exploded to far more than 100,000.

It was then she decided to take her organization offline and into a true-lifestyle retail outlet.
